Grow with AppMaster Grow with AppMaster.
Become our partner arrow ico

سحب وإفلات بدون رمز </ h2>

السحب والإفلات No-Code ، الذي يشار إليه غالبًا ببساطة drag-and-drop ، هو طريقة سهلة الاستخدام وبديهية يتم استخدامها في منصات تطوير بدون تعليمات برمجية لإنشاء وتصميم وتخصيص مكونات ووظائف متنوعة للتطبيقات دون الحاجة إلى بحاجة لكتابة التعليمات البرمجية اليدوية. يمكّن هذا النهج الأفراد ، بما في ذلك محللو الأعمال وخبراء المجال والمستخدمون غير التقنيين ، من المشاركة بنشاط في عملية تطوير التطبيق من خلال التجميع المرئي للعناصر والتفاعلات باستخدام إيماءات drag-and-drop.

يمثل مفهوم drag-and-drop no-code نقلة نوعية تحولية في عالم تطوير البرمجيات. من الناحية التاريخية ، يتطلب تطوير التطبيقات التقليدية خبرة واسعة في الترميز ، مما يجعلها مجالًا مخصصًا لمهندسي البرمجيات والمبرمجين. ومع ذلك ، مع ظهور منصات تطوير no-code مثل AppMaster ، تم تفكيك الحواجز التي تحول دون الدخول ، مما سمح لمجموعة أوسع من الأفراد بالمساهمة في إنشاء تطبيقات برمجية.

تعتبر عملية استخدام ميزات drag-and-drop no-code داخل هذه الأنظمة الأساسية واضحة ولكنها مؤثرة. وهي تشمل مراحل مختلفة ، يساهم كل منها في تجربة تطوير التطبيقات السلسة والبديهية:

  • المكونات المرئية: في صميم drag-and-drop no-code تكمن مكتبة شاملة من المكونات المرئية المصممة مسبقًا. تعمل هذه المكونات كوحدات بناء يمكن للمستخدمين من خلالها التحديد والسحب إلى لوحة التطبيق. من الأزرار والحقول النصية إلى الصور والمخططات والنماذج ، تمكّن هذه العناصر المستخدمين من إنشاء واجهة المستخدم (UI) لتطبيقاتهم بسرعة.
  • تخصيص المكون: بمجرد وضعه على اللوحة القماشية ، تكون قوة التخصيص في متناول المستخدم. تسمح الإعدادات والتكوينات البديهية بتخصيص مظهر وسلوك كل مكون. يتضمن ذلك عمليات ضبط مثل الأحجام والألوان والخطوط والمحاذاة. علاوة على ذلك ، تمتد الخيارات الديناميكية إلى تحديد سلوكيات التفاعل ، مثل إجراءات النقر أو الرسوم المتحركة ، وبث الحياة بشكل فعال في الواجهة الأمامية للتطبيق.
  • ربط البيانات وتكاملها: تعمل منصات drag-and-drop No-code على دمج البيانات بسلاسة في عملية التطوير. يمكن للمستخدمين إنشاء اتصالات بين مكونات واجهة المستخدم ومصادر البيانات ، بما في ذلك قواعد البيانات وواجهات برمجة التطبيقات والخدمات الخارجية. من خلال إجراءات drag-and-drop البسيطة ، يتم تحقيق تكامل البيانات في الوقت الفعلي ، مما يضمن استمرار تحديث التطبيق بأحدث المعلومات.
  • سير العمل والتصميم المنطقي: لا تقتصر الطبيعة البديهية drag-and-drop على العناصر المرئية ؛ يمتد إلى منطق التطبيق وتصميم سير العمل. يمكن للمستخدمين توصيل المكونات والإجراءات المختلفة بسهولة باستخدام إيماءات drag-and-drop. هذا يمكّنهم من تحديد تسلسل الخطوات في عملية الأعمال ، وتحديد كيفية تدفق البيانات بين الشاشات ، وتحديد سلوك التفاعلات.
  • تصميم سريع الاستجابة: إدراكًا لتنوع الأجهزة وأحجام الشاشات ، غالبًا ما تتبنى منصات drag-and-drop no-code برمجية مبادئ التصميم سريعة الاستجابة. وهذا يضمن أن تطبيقات drag-and-drop تتكيف بسلاسة مع أبعاد واتجاهات الشاشة المختلفة. والنتيجة هي تجربة مستخدم متماسكة ومتسقة عبر الهواتف الذكية والأجهزة اللوحية وأجهزة الكمبيوتر المحمولة وأجهزة الكمبيوتر المكتبية.

يمكن ملاحظة التأثير العميق drag-and-drop no-code على تطوير التطبيقات من خلال عدة عدسات رئيسية:

  • التمكين والتحول إلى الديمقراطية: إن ظهور drag-and-drop no-code هو خطوة تحولية نحو إضفاء الطابع الديمقراطي على تطوير البرمجيات. إنه يمكّن الخبراء المتخصصين ومحللي الأعمال والأفراد الذين ليس لديهم خلفيات ترميز واسعة النطاق للمشاركة بنشاط في إنشاء تطبيقات وظيفية وذات مغزى. هذا التمكين يغذي بيئة تعاونية حيث يمكن للأشخاص الأقرب إلى احتياجات العمل تشكيل الحلول التقنية بشكل مباشر.
  • النماذج الأولية السريعة والتكرار: تتجلى السرعة التي يوفرها drag-and-drop no-code بشكل خاص في مجال النماذج الأولية السريعة والتطوير التكراري. يمكن للمستخدمين ترجمة المفاهيم بسرعة إلى نماذج أولية ملموسة ، وتجربة العديد من التخطيطات والوظائف. تعمل العملية التكرارية لتنقية هذه النماذج الأولية وتحسينها على تسريع دورة حياة التطوير ، وتعزيز إنشاء التطبيقات التي تلقى صدى حقيقيًا لدى المستخدمين.
  • كفاءة الوقت والتكلفة: drag-and-drop No-code يحدث ثورة في كفاءة تطوير التطبيق. من خلال تجنب الحاجة إلى الترميز اليدوي ، يتم تقليل وقت التطوير بشكل كبير. يمكن الآن تنفيذ التطبيقات التي كانت تتطلب في السابق جهودًا مكثفة في الترميز في جزء صغير من الوقت ، مما يؤدي إلى توفير التكاليف وتسريع طرحها في السوق.
  • التعاون والفرق متعددة الوظائف: الطبيعة الشاملة drag-and-drop no-code تغذي التعاون متعدد الوظائف. يمكن للفرق الفنية وغير الفنية التعاون بسلاسة ، وسد الفجوة بين مطوري البرامج وأصحاب المصلحة في الأعمال. يضمن هذا التوافق أن التطبيقات المطورة لا تلبي المتطلبات الفنية فحسب ، بل تتماشى أيضًا بشكل وثيق مع أهداف العمل.
  • تصميم يركز على المستخدم: الطبيعة المرئية والتفاعلية للسحب والإفلات تُمكِّن المطورين والمصممين من إنشاء تطبيقات بتركيز قوي على المستخدم. يمكنهم تصور كيفية تفاعل المستخدمين النهائيين مع التطبيق بشكل مباشر ، مما يسمح باتخاذ قرارات تصميم مستنيرة تعمل على تحسين تجربة المستخدم والمشاركة.
  • قابلية التوسع والتحديثات: تتيح منصات drag-and-drop No-code للتطبيقات التوسع بأمان. مع توسع قواعد المستخدمين وزيادة أحجام البيانات ، يمكن تحديث التطبيقات وتحسينها بشكل متكرر دون بذل جهود كبيرة في الترميز. تضمن هذه المرونة أن تظل التطبيقات مستجيبة وفعالة حتى في مواجهة الطلبات المتطورة.

drag-and-drop No-code هو مفهوم أساسي في تطوير التطبيقات الحديثة التي تمكن الأفراد الذين ليس لديهم خبرة في الترميز من إنشاء تطبيقات وظيفية وجذابة بصريًا. من خلال توفير طريقة سهلة الاستخدام ويمكن الوصول إليها لتصميم مكونات واجهة المستخدم وتحديد التفاعلات ودمج البيانات ، تعمل منصات drag-and-drop no-code مثل AppMaster على تمكين جمهور أوسع من المشاركة بنشاط في دورة حياة تطوير البرامج. مع استمرار تطور صناعة no-code ، ستظل أهمية drag-and-drop no-code كنهج تحويلي لإنشاء التطبيقات والابتكار قوة دافعة في تشكيل مستقبل تطوير البرمجيات.

المنشورات ذات الصلة

لغة البرمجة المرئية مقابل الترميز التقليدي: أيهما أكثر كفاءة؟
لغة البرمجة المرئية مقابل الترميز التقليدي: أيهما أكثر كفاءة؟
استكشاف كفاءة لغات البرمجة المرئية مقارنة بالترميز التقليدي، وتسليط الضوء على المزايا والتحديات للمطورين الذين يسعون إلى حلول مبتكرة.
كيف يساعدك منشئ تطبيقات الذكاء الاصطناعي بدون أكواد في إنشاء برامج أعمال مخصصة
كيف يساعدك منشئ تطبيقات الذكاء الاصطناعي بدون أكواد في إنشاء برامج أعمال مخصصة
اكتشف قوة منشئي تطبيقات الذكاء الاصطناعي بدون أكواد في إنشاء برامج أعمال مخصصة. اكتشف كيف تعمل هذه الأدوات على تمكين التطوير الفعّال وإضفاء الطابع الديمقراطي على إنشاء البرامج.
كيفية تعزيز الإنتاجية باستخدام برنامج رسم الخرائط المرئية
كيفية تعزيز الإنتاجية باستخدام برنامج رسم الخرائط المرئية
عزز إنتاجيتك باستخدام برنامج رسم الخرائط المرئية. اكتشف التقنيات والفوائد والرؤى العملية لتحسين سير العمل من خلال الأدوات المرئية.
ابدأ مجانًا
من وحي تجربة هذا بنفسك؟

أفضل طريقة لفهم قوة AppMaster هي رؤيتها بنفسك. اصنع تطبيقك الخاص في دقائق مع اشتراك مجاني

اجعل أفكارك تنبض بالحياة